the album is titled blonde because blonde hair is often bright when one is young, but it begins to darken as they age. this is used to discuss how we lose our freedom with age. this theory is supported by the fact that after the nights beat switch, the album takes a darker tone. in the first half of the album (before nights) frank uses high-pitched vocals to represent his younger self. he also mentions the word summer several times in this album which represents youth and freedom. in the second half of the album (after the nights beat switch) he only references summer once when Andre 3000 says he is “watching the summer come close to an end” which represents the end of his childhood.

Nikes is not like any other song I've ever heard. This dynamic synth, creating an expanding and shrinking melody almost simulating a breathing chorus. Then these drums and snares are the only percussion instruments keeping a slow rhythm on the track making you feel as if you're underwater or on drugs. Don't even get me started on the bells through out the ending of the song and the way he starts it with the high pitched voice. Never done before but feels like it should've because it is the most perfectly arranged song. Not even a song, but a beautiful, magical master piece. This is how music should be done.
